Pune University Initiates Skill Development Drive: Affiliated Colleges Encouraged to Establish Skill Centers

In a significant development aimed at empowering college students for the professional world, the Director of the Skill Development Centre at Savitribai Phule Pune University (SPPU) has called upon all affiliated colleges to establish Skill Development Centers within their campuses. This initiative, influenced by the vision of Maharashtra’s Minister of Tourism and Ministry of Skill Development and Entrepreneurship, Mangal Prabhat Lodha, seeks to elevate the employability of college students by integrating academic education with practical business skills.

Vision for Statewide Impact

As part of the larger vision of the Maharashtra State’s Skill Development, Employment, Entrepreneurship, and Innovation Department, the plan is to establish Skill Development Centers in 100 colleges across the state. This ambitious undertaking reflects the commitment to preparing college youths for the challenges and opportunities presented by the evolving job market.
